vue开发移动端app框架

Vue是一个轻量级的JavaScript框架,它可以用于构建Web应用程序,也可以用于构建移动应用程序。Vue的主要特点是易于学习和使用,具有高效的性能和灵活的可扩展性。Vue的移动开发框架主要是基于Vue和其他相关技术构建而成的。

Vue的移动开发框架主要由以下几个方面组成:

1. Vue.js:Vue.js是一个轻量级的JavaScript框架,它可以用于构建Web应用程序和移动应用程序。它提供了一些基本的组件和指令,使得开发人员可以更加简单和方便地构建移动应用程序。

2. Vue Router:Vue Router是一个官方的路由管理器,它可以帮助开发人员构建单页应用程序。它提供了一些基本的组件和指令,使得开发人员可以更加简单和方便地构建移动应用程序。

3. Vuex:Vuex是一个官方的状态管理器,它可以帮助开发人员更好地管理应用程序的状态。它提供了一些基本的组件和指令,使得开发人员可以更加简单和方便地构建移动应用程序。

4. Axios:Axios是一个基于Promise的HTTP客户端,它可以帮助开发人员更好地处理API请求和响应。它提供了一些基本的组件和指令,使得开发人员可以更加简单和方便地构建移动应用程序。

5. Vant:Vant是一个基于Vue的移动端UI组件库,它提供了一些常用的移动端UI组件,如按钮、输入框、轮播图等。它可以帮助开发人员更加快速地构建移动应用程序。

Vue的移动开发框架主要原理是基于组件化开发的思想,将整个应用程序划分为多个组件,每个组件都有自己的状态和行为,可以通过props和events进行通信和交互。在Vue的移动开发框架中,每个组件都可以自己定义样式和布局,使得整个应用程序具有更好的可维护性和扩展性。

总的来说,Vue的移动开发框架是一个非常强大和灵活的框架,它可以帮助开发人员更加简单、快速、高效地构建移动应用程序。它的原理和实现方式非常简单和易于理解,任何人都可以轻松上手。